Írjon visszajelzéstJoy Yee is definitely a must-visit spot in Chicago's Chinatown. The menu offers a wide variety of options, with standout dishes like delicious pho made with high-quality ingredients. The spring rolls and boba teas are also fantastic. The service is quick and efficient, with plenty of friendly servers available. We make sure to stop by Joy Yee every time we're in Chicago.
I ordered the bubble waffle with mango and pomelo. The flavor was good, but I found the $10 price to be a bit steep. There was not much pomelo on it, and there was an excess of whipped cream, which I am not a fan of.
We ordered the Tea Baby, Thai Milk Tea, and Charcoal Ice Cream at this restaurant. We enjoyed all of them, although we were unsure of the flavor of the charcoal ice cream - it tasted a bit like butter over corn. Nevertheless, it was delicious!
Amazing! We had Shabu Shabu for the first time and loved it! The portions were so big. One beef combo definately feeds two to three people easily. I was so stuffed. The beef broth was delicious. We ordered an extra side of dumplings to add to the broth.There were so many options for add ons or extra noodles or meat. Our server was friendly and helpful. We both got the bobawaffle ice cream for dessert which was amazing as well. I highly recommend trying the Shabu Shabu. And for bubble tea Joy Yee isthe best!
